November 2015 Child sex offender lured schoolboys with drink and drugs – Jailed 14-years FOUR men have told a court how as boys they were lured with drink and drugs to the home of a sex abuser, who has now been jailed for 14 years. The men, who are now in their 30s, told Derby Crown Court yesterday that Jonathan Land, who at the time of the offences in the 1990s lived near a school in Spondon, had ruined their lives and harmed their mental health. One of the victims, who Land groomed and abused from the age of 11 to 14, said: “He has ruined and taken my childhood away from me and I can never get that back. “Even now, I suffer with depression and paranoia and have wanted to end my life so many times. “I have never moved on with my life and feel stuck in the time when my abuse happened.” Land, 48, now of Hillcrest Road, Derby, was convicted by a jury of 17 counts of indecent and serious sexual assaults on the four victims in the 1990s. Jailing Land, Judge Nirmal Shant QC said: “Over a period of many years, you groomed these four boys and… despite your limitations you were well able and did manipulate them in such a way, when they should have been in school and learning, you lured them into your parents’ home with drink and drugs and you did that in order that you could abuse them, and that’s exactly what you did. “The fact is, what you did had a very profound effect on the course of their lives.” Police launched an investigation in March last year, during which they identified and spoke to a large number of men who had attended Land’s address in the 1990s. All of them confirmed the accounts given by the victims about Land providing drugs and alcohol to young boys in Spondon. Following the sentencing, the victim, who was abused from age 11, said: “He was very manipulative. He would make you feel like you needed him. It was weird how he got into your head. “The reason I kept going back and back is that I felt safe around him, even though he was abusing me. When I think back, I realise it was to do with all the grooming he did. “I now feel like Superman that we got him 14 years, and he deserves every single year of it. I can now start moving on with my life.” Another victim, who was abused at age 13, said his attacker tied him to a bed and undid his jeans. The man said: “I started going into a panic and I threatened to scream so that his mum and dad would hear me, so he slacked off and I managed to get free. “I never went back after that. We believe there are more victims and hope they will come forward to the police, who have been absolutely wonderful through the whole investigation.”
